3.4 Measuring Light – Exposure Metering
1. Press button [A] to adjust the exposure metering mode. There are three
dierent exposure metering mode options that are displayed sequentially
when either the front or rear dial is turned. Select an appropriate exposure
mode. Your chosen exposure metering mode is displayed as an icon on the
cameras LCD screen.
2. Press the SET button [B] or exposure metering mode button [A] to enter
the setting.
Exposure Warnings
Users are warned when shooting subjects that are too bright or too dark with
an inappropriate exposure setting. At such times, when the correct exposure
cannot be obtained, users will be alerted by the numeric exposure display
that will ash on the external LCD or on the display inside the viewnder.
Warnings that the exposure is outside the metering range
• Program AE (P)
The shutter speed and f-number blink.
• Aperture priority AE (Av)
The shutter speed blinks.
• Shutter priority AE (Tv)
The f-number blinks.
• Manual mode (M)
The exposure metering value dierence is displayed.
Average/spot auto
exposure metering
Exposure metering is performed after automatically selecting
average/spot exposure metering.• Depending on the subject
conditions, center-weighted average/spot exposure metering is
selected automatically, and the correct exposure is measured.
• Spot exposure metering is automatically selected when the
brightness of the spot exposure metering range becomes darker
than the brightness of the entire screen.
• If there is very little dierence between the spot exposure metering
value and center-weighted average exposure metering value, the
correct exposure level is obtained as the intermediate value.
Center-weighted
average/spot exposure
metering
The average brightness of the entire screen is measured,
emphasizing the center of the screen.
Center spot exposure
metering
The brightness of an area equivalent to 7.6% at screen center is
measured, and the exposure is determined. The circle at screen
center serves as a general guideline. This mode is suited to
measuring subjects with strong contrasts or measuring only screen
portions.
